    Assessment of the Mouth01:26

    Assessment of the Mouth

    308
    A thorough mouth assessment, including inspection and palpation of the lips, gums, tongue, tonsils, uvula, and pharynx, is crucial in detecting potential health issues. Diseases ranging from oral cancer to systemic conditions like diabetes could be identified early through careful oral examination. This article provides a detailed guide on conducting a comprehensive mouth assessment.
    Mouth Inspection
    The inspection begins with visually examining the mouth for symmetry, color, and size.
